SALT LAKE CITY (Feb. 13, 2020) – Gov. Gary R. Herbert has appointed Teresa Wilhelmsen, P.E., as state engineer and director of the Utah Division of Water Rights. Wilhelmsen has worked for the division for the past 23 years and currently serves as assistant state engineer. This bill updated Section 73-2-1 of the Utah Code, which gives the State Engineer authority to make rules for the construction of wells and the licensing of well drillers. This section was updated by the passage of HB177 to require the State … Wilhelmsen joined the Division of Water Rights in 1997 and most recently served as an assistant state engineer and the division’s hearing officer. Prior to that, she served as a regional engineer at the Utah Lake and Jordan River Regional Office, and as the division’s adjudication program manager. WRPOD is a point shapefile created nightly from data in the Utah Division of Water Rights database. It contains water right point of diversion information. The coordinate system is UTM zone 12. Salt Lake City, UT 84114-6300.Mar 23, 2021 · About Water Rights The Division of Water Rights ("Division") is the state agency that regulates the appropria- tion and distribution of water in the State of Utah (Utah Code, Title 73, Chapters 1-6). It is an office of public record for water right documentation. In 1967, the name of the Office of the State Engineer was changed to the Division of Water Rights with the State Engineer designated as the Director. The Division of Water Rights is the state agency that regulates the appropriation and distribution of water in the state of Utah. It is an office of public record for information pertaining to water rights, excepting that related to water right ownership. Many real estate agencies will have listings for water rights much as they do for properties.The Water Rights Certification Exam is an online, open book exam consisting of 100 multiple choice questions. This exam is not offered without the class. It is available at the end of each Water Rights class. You have 2 hours to complete the exam. At the end of two hours, all unanswered questions are marked incomplete, and the exam is closed.Mar 4, 2024 · State of Utah, Division of Water Rights Recharge and Recovery List : Reuse Applications 3/4/2024 9:11:10 PM .
